A psychiatrist is a medical doctor who has special training in the care of patients suffering from mental illness. They treat conditions like depression, anxiety disorders bipolar disorders, depression and eating disorders. They may also prescribe medications to help patients manage symptoms. Common medications include antidepressants, antipsychotic mediations, mood stabilizers and sedatives. They may also suggest psychotherapy or talk therapy to help alleviate symptoms.

A psychiatrist, also known as a Psychiatrist is a medical specialist who deals with mental illnesses. This includes anxiety and depression, bipolar disorder and eating disorders, OCD and ADHD. Psychologists are more skilled and educated than therapists and can prescribe medication and offer therapy for talk. They can also conduct different tests to determine your condition.

Psychiatrists have completed a minimum of 12 years of medical school and undergraduate training, along with four or more years in a hospital residency setting. They are knowledgeable of how mental and physical health are interconnected and can prescribe medication as required.
